분류 전체보기 57

[아이티윌 빅데이터 52기] Day 3 SQL 함수 2 그룹 조회

SQL 함수2 그룹 조회-날짜 시간 함수-형변환 / 조건 함수-집계 함수-그룹 조회-윈도우 함수 날짜 시간 함수 1. 현재 날짜/ 시간 조회 : NOW() CURDATE() CURTIME()NOW() 현재 날짜와 시간 반환CURDATE(): 현재 날짜만 반환CURTIME():현재 시간 반환 *컴퓨터에 내장된 값을 가져오기 때문에 FROM 안 붙음SELECT NOW() AS 현재_날짜시간, CURDATE() AS 오늘날짜, CURTIME() AS 현재시간; 2,테이블에 저장된 날짜 데이터를 가져오는 DATE() ,TIME()-데이터 타입이 날짜/시간인 경우에 대해 활용 가능 3. YEAR() MONTH () DAY()년도 월 일자를 추출 4.DATE_ADD () 날짜 연산DATE_ADD(DATE, I..

[아이티윌 빅데이터 52기] Day 2 데이터 검색하기 SQL 함수

데이터 검색하기 SQL 함수 1-데이터 검색하기-집합 연산자-문자열 함수-숫자 함수 WHERE ,UNION, INTERSECT ,EXCEPT, 를 이해문자열/숫자 함수의 종류 파악 WHERE 절의 사용-특정 검색 조건을 만족하는 행만 조회-비교 / 논리/ SQL 연산자 비교 연산자 : = . != , ,>= , 논리 연산자 : AND . OR . NOT -AND 모든 조건이 참 / OR 하나라도 참 -괄호를 적용하면 우선적으로 적용 SELECT * FROM STUDENTS WHERE (GRADE =1 OR GRADE = 2) AND STATUS = '재학;ORDER BY GRADE ASC; -AND 가 OR 보다 우선적으로 적용SELECT * FROM STUDENTS WHERE GRADE =1..

[아이티윌 빅데이터 52기] Day 1 데이터 베이스의 시작하기

마리아 DB 는?거시적인 UI 없이 백그라운드에서 작동하는 서버 프로그램 *커맨드 라인 인터페이스 CLI이와 반대되는 사용자 인터페이스가 있으면 GUI 라고 함 서버와 클라이언트클라이언트는 특정 요청을 보내는 입장 (웹 브라우저 , 배달앱)서버는 요처을 받아 처리하는 입장 (웹 사이트, 배달 시스템) 마리아 DB 접근하기단축키 : 윈도우 + R 누르면 아래와 같은 옵션이 활성화 되고, cmd 를 누르면 터미널로 진입함 C:\Users\itwill>mariadb -uroot -pEnter password: ****Welcome to the MariaDB monitor. Commands end with ; or \g.Your MariaDB connection id is 8Server version:..

[R스튜디오 출석 수업] 1-6강

-R의 장단점-세미콜론-NA (결측치) / -Inf (무한대) / NaN (값이 정의 XX)-na.rm=TRUE (결측치를 제외하고 계산하는 옵션 1. R 은 오픈소스 (널리 쓰인다, 응용이 쉽다, 누구나 쓸 수 있다) 2.단점오픈소스이기 때문에 단점이 발생하기도 함 > 개별 패키지마다 사용법을 익히기도 해야함 3. 콜론하고 세미콜론 헷갈리지 말고 세미콜론 꼭 확인 ! 4. 여러개의 원소를 가지고 있는 데이터 구조 관련된 문제가 거의 10-15문제그래픽 보다는 앞쪽이 더 많아 3-4문제 *이 그래프를 만들 때 쓰이는 코드는? 그래픽두 변수의 관계를 살펴볼 수 있는 그래프는?>산점도 그래프다 확률 밀도를 나타내는 그래프는? 삼차원을 구연하는 그래프는? 단계구분도의 기능은 무엇인가?다음 그림이..

카테고리 없음 2025.05.11

[R 스튜디오] 배열 / 리스트 / 데이터 프레임

1. 배열-행렬을 2차원 이상으로 확장시킨 객체-2차원 구조로 이뤄진 행렬도 일종의 배열이라고 할 수 있고일반적으로는 3차원 이상의 데이터 객체를 배열이라고 함 length : 자료의 개수mode : 자료의 형태dim : 각 차원의 크기dimnames : 각 차원 리스트의 이름  예를 들어서 행렬은 matrix(1:12,c(4,3))  1~ 12 까지의 숫차를 4개의 행 , 3개의 열로 만드는건데  [,1] [,2] [,3][1,] 1 5 9[2,] 2 6 10[3,] 3 7 11[4,] 4 8 12 배열은 행, 열 , 행렬의 갯수로 표현즉 여기는 3*3 을 2개 만드는건데숫자는 1~24 사이니까 18까지만 나와array(1:24,c(3,..

카테고리 없음 2025.03.19

[R 스튜디오] 벡터

1. 벡터-벡터는 한 개 이상의 원소를 구성한 자료 구조-R 의 자료 객체 중 가장 기본이 되는 자료 개체-하나의 벡터 원소는 한 가지 형태(mode) 만 가능- c() scan() seq() rep() 함수로 생성 가능  1.1c()c(1,2,3,4,5)c(1:5)  *세미콜론 ; 은 여러 명령을 한번에 실행할 때 쓰이고, 그냥 콜론은 일종의 수열 연산x > 30이 출력 *c() 함수 안에는 문자형 벡터도 만들 수 있어! 다만 이때는 각 원소에 "" 를 넣어줘야해a *벡터의 길이, 즉 원소의 갯수를 세는 함수는 length()    *c() 함수를 이용하여 논리형 벡터도 생성 가능c(F,F,T)    *위에서 하나의 벡터에 하나의 데이터 형식만 사용되는 것처럼 데이터 형식이 혼용되어 쓰이진 않음  2...

카테고리 없음 2025.03.11

[R 스튜디오] 함수 - cbind() scan() write.csv() read.csv()

1.cbind ()내가 만든 c 값들을 합칠 수 있어xycbind(x,y)x y1 102 203 304 405 50     2,scan() 관측값을 바로 넣을 수 있음w1      3.edit()titi titi=edit(titi) titi 가 데이터 프레임이란 구조라는 걸 인식해준 후,titi 에 들어갈 값은 내가 엑셀 형식으로 넣어줄거야 ! 라고 해석 할 수 있어  위처럼 실핼시키면 이런 엑셀창이 뜸 이렇게 저장된 titi 는 따로 확인도 가능~    1.sink(): 화면에 출력된 모든 결과를 파일로 저장하는 것(시작 할 떄 저장할 파일 이름을 정해주고, 원하는 함수를 실행시킨 후 종료 시 sink() 로 끝 )   예를 들어서sink('printa.txt')summary(iris)sink()   ..

카테고리 없음 2025.03.10

[R 스튜디오] 디렉토리 - 상대경로 절대 경로

1. R 을 활용할 떄 작업 디렉토리를 설정하고 변경해야함 콘솔에 있는 경로가 내가 지금 있는 경로이고상대 경로를 쓴다면 . -> 현재폴더 .. -> 이전폴더 ~ -> 디폴트값 (home)인데, 절대 경로로 쓴다면 이렇게 속성에서 확인 가능다만 \ 를 정규식처럼 문자로 인식해야하니까 \\ 로 쓰게 되는 경우가 더 많을거임 예를 들어서 '방통대' 라는 문서가C:\Users\bohee\Documents\방통대 C:\Users\bohee\Documents\Downloads  라는 경로가 있을 때Downloads 경로에서 방통대로 가고 싶으면?setwd('..\Documents\방통대')  이렇게 앞/뒤 위치 관계를 써줘야하는데절대 경로로 쓰면 그냥  setwd(' C:\\Users\\bohee\\Documen..

카테고리 없음 2025.03.10

[통계학개론] 1강 데이터와 통계학

1.통계학의 기본 개념-데이터는 어떤 현상을 이해하기 위해 그 현상을 관찰하여 데이터를 수집한 것 ( 설문조사, 실험 등)-통계학은 불확실한 현상 이해를 위해 데이터 수집, 요약, 추론 (결론) 을 찾는 학문 모집단 (전체 집단) -- 모수 (모집단의 특성을 나타내는 대푯값)표본(모집단을 알기 위해 실제로 관측한 모집단의 일부)  --통계량 (표본의 특성을 나타내는 대푯값)  2. R 스튜디오 기초(1) 객체 'aba+b = 7  (2)벡터 - 어떤 값들이 일렬로 있는 것2.1 c(1,2,3,4) , c(1:4) 1,2,3,42.2 seq(1,8,2) 1,3,5,7 2.3 hh = 1,2,3,4,1,3,5,7   (3) 데이터의 형식3.1 숫자형3.2 범위형as.factor (1:4)  >> 숫자 1~4..

카테고리 없음 2025.02.17

[데벨챌 4기 현장 토크쇼] '그로스해킹' 양승화 저자님과의 만남

'그로스해킹' 저자 양승화님 북토크쇼에 가다!3주간의 독서 챌린지 후, 감사하게 당첨된 토크쇼11월 첫 주 ~ 셋째주 까지 매주 주말 막바지에 열심히그로스해킹 책을 읽고 블로그 글을 써서 올려온 가장 큰 이유....바로 '그로스해킹' 책 저자님과의 북 토크쇼에 참가를 '신청' 할 수 있는 자격을 얻을 수 있기 때문이었다....!(어찌보면 이번 챌린지의 가장 큰 동기부여가 이 북토크쇼 였던 것 같기도 하다)이렇게 마지막 글을 업로드 하고, 별도로 신청을 했더니 자동으로 봇이 인증 완료 + 신청 완료 알람을 보내줬다 ㅎㅎ그리고 다행히....당첨~~!회사에서 같이 이번 챌린지랑 북토크쇼를 신청했던 개발자 분은 데이터리안 수업을 수강한 적이 없어서 걱정하셨는데(나같은 경우 예전에 SQL 수업을 들은 적이 있어서..

카테고리 없음 2025.01.26